From: Bjorn Helgaas <bhelgaas@google.com> Date: Thu, 12 Mar 2015 17:30:06 +0000 (-0500) Subject: PCI: Mark invalid BARs as unassigned X-Git-Tag: pci-v4.1-changes~3^3~2 X-Git-Url: https://www.infradead.org/git/?a=commitdiff_plain;h=c770cb4cb505;p=users%2Fdwmw2%2Flinux.git PCI: Mark invalid BARs as unassigned If a BAR is not inside any upstream bridge window, or if it conflicts with another resource, mark it as IORESOURCE_UNSET so we don't try to use it. We may be able to assign a different address for it. Signed-off-by: Bjorn Helgaas <bhelgaas@google.com> Acked-by: Rafael J.
